在科技飞速发展的今天,SLAM(Simultaneous Localization and Mapping,即同时定位与建图)技术已经渗透到了我们生活的方方面面。从无人机的精准导航,到智能家居的智能服务,SLAM技术正在悄然改变着我们的生活。本文将带你揭开SLAM技术的神秘面纱,了解它在现实生活中的应用。
SLAM技术概述
SLAM技术是一种在未知环境中,通过传感器数据获取环境信息,实现自主定位和建图的技术。它融合了计算机视觉、机器学习、控制理论等多个领域,具有广泛的应用前景。
SLAM技术的基本原理
SLAM技术的基本原理是将传感器获取的实时数据与预先存储的环境信息进行匹配,从而实现定位和建图。具体来说,主要包括以下步骤:
- 数据采集:通过搭载在设备上的传感器(如摄像头、激光雷达等)采集环境信息。
- 特征提取:从采集到的数据中提取具有代表性的特征点,如角点、边缘等。
- 匹配与优化:将当前帧的特征点与地图上的特征点进行匹配,并通过优化算法更新设备的位置和地图信息。
- 建图:将匹配后的特征点连接成图,形成对环境的描述。
SLAM技术的优势
SLAM技术具有以下优势:
- 自主性:SLAM技术可以在未知环境中自主完成定位和建图,无需外部引导。
- 实时性:SLAM技术可以实时获取环境信息,实现快速定位和建图。
- 适应性:SLAM技术可以适应不同的环境和场景,具有广泛的应用前景。
SLAM技术在无人机导航中的应用
无人机导航是SLAM技术的重要应用领域之一。通过SLAM技术,无人机可以自主完成对飞行环境的感知、定位和建图,实现精准导航。
无人机导航的SLAM技术实现
无人机导航的SLAM技术主要包括以下步骤:
- 数据采集:通过无人机搭载的摄像头、激光雷达等传感器采集环境信息。
- 特征提取:从采集到的数据中提取特征点,如地面的角点、建筑物边缘等。
- 匹配与优化:将当前帧的特征点与地图上的特征点进行匹配,并通过优化算法更新无人机的位置和地图信息。
- 路径规划:根据地图信息,规划无人机的飞行路径,实现精准导航。
无人机导航的SLAM技术应用实例
- 农业喷洒:无人机利用SLAM技术进行精准喷洒,提高农药利用率,降低环境污染。
- 电力巡检:无人机利用SLAM技术进行输电线路巡检,提高巡检效率,降低安全隐患。
- 灾害救援:无人机利用SLAM技术进行灾区环境监测,为救援人员提供实时信息。
SLAM技术在智能家居中的应用
智能家居是SLAM技术的另一个重要应用领域。通过SLAM技术,智能家居设备可以实现对家庭环境的感知、定位和建图,为用户提供更加智能化的服务。
智能家居的SLAM技术实现
智能家居的SLAM技术主要包括以下步骤:
- 数据采集:通过智能家居设备(如摄像头、传感器等)采集家庭环境信息。
- 特征提取:从采集到的数据中提取特征点,如家具、家电等。
- 匹配与优化:将当前帧的特征点与地图上的特征点进行匹配,并通过优化算法更新设备的位置和地图信息。
- 智能服务:根据地图信息,实现智能家居设备的智能化服务,如自动调节室内温度、灯光等。
智能家居的SLAM技术应用实例
- 智能安防:通过SLAM技术实现家庭环境的实时监控,提高家庭安全。
- 智能清洁:通过SLAM技术实现扫地机器人的自主清洁,提高清洁效率。
- 智能娱乐:通过SLAM技术实现家庭娱乐设备的精准定位,提高用户体验。
总结
SLAM技术作为一种强大的空间定位与建图技术,已经在无人机导航和智能家居等领域取得了显著的应用成果。随着技术的不断发展,SLAM技术将在更多领域发挥重要作用,为我们的生活带来更多便利。让我们一起期待SLAM技术带来的美好未来!